An Improved Test for Mad Cow Disease

Researchers have developed a new test for bovine spongiform encephalopathy, or mad cow disease, that they say is faster and more reliable for identifying the disease than current tests, which can only detect the disease after the cow dies. More...
The test was described at the annual meeting of the American Chemical Society in New York (NY, USA).

Called a conformation-dependent immunoassay (CDI), the automated test can detect prion proteins with 100% accuracy at much smaller levels than conventional tests and takes only about five hours to produce results. Although designed for detecting prions in the brain tissue of cows only upon autopsy, the test also shows promise for detecting prions in muscle tissue and even blood while a cow is still alive. In a field trial, the test was used to check for signs of the disease in the brains of 11,000 slaughtered cows. The results were the same as those of standard immunoassays performed on the same animals.

"This represents a new generation of prion tests,” said project leader Dr. Jiri G. Safar, M.D., an associate adjunct professor at the University of California, San Francisco (USA). "It is the most promising to date for accurately detecting prion proteins.” The group plans to use the test on an even larger scale among European cattle herds within the next year. The test can detect up to eight different strains of prions, including those that cause scrapie in sheep and chronic wasting disease in deer.
